I am programming using S4. I define two classes, "B" is inheriting from "A". Apparently (at least since version 2.9.0 ?), when the correct signature is not find, R prefers to chose a signature in the ancestor BEFORE a signature in the class. This is very strange to me...

If I define plot for ("A",missing) and ("B",ANY), calling plot("B",missing), I would expect R to chose plot("B",ANY) before plot("A",missing)
